Fluoride treatment stands as a cornerstone in the prevention of tooth decay and the maintenance of oral health. This naturally occurring mineral plays a crucial role in strengthening tooth enamel, the hard outer layer of your teeth. By enhancing the enamel’s resistance to acid attacks from plaque bacteria and sugars in the mouth, fluoride helps prevent the development of cavities.

Our dentists and team often recommend fluoride treatments during routine checkups, especially for patients at high risk of tooth decay. These treatments contain a higher concentration of fluoride than what is found in toothpaste, mouth rinses or water supplies. Applied directly to the teeth through gels, varnishes or foams, these treatments offer substantial benefits in combating tooth decay and supporting overall dental health.

Children, in particular, can gain significant advantages from fluoride treatments as their developing teeth are fortified, providing a solid foundation for a lifetime of oral health. However, adults can benefit too, especially if they have conditions that put them at an increased risk of dental caries, such as dry mouth, gum disease or a history of frequent cavities.

Fluoride treatment is a quick and simple procedure that can be seamlessly integrated into your dental care routine. After the application, Dr. James Tatum or Dr. James Ashcraft might advise you to avoid eating or drinking for a short period to allow the fluoride to fully adhere to the tooth surfaces.

In addition to professional treatments, incorporating fluoride-containing products into your daily oral hygiene regimen can offer ongoing protection against tooth decay. Drinking fluoridated water and using fluoride toothpaste are effective ways to ensure you receive a consistent dose of this enamel-strengthening mineral.
